WebLace washing process: Use one teaspoon to a gallon of warm water (115 degrees F). Line your sink with an old towel that can be used as a sling for picking up the wet tablecloth. Immerse the tablecloth and let it sit for 45 minutes to an hour, without agitation. Rinse, letting the water run and drain at the same time. Rinsing may take up to an hour. WebJan 27, 2024 · To effectively remove a greasy stain from a tablecloth while it is still damp, sprinkle it with talcum powder or flour. Let the talc absorb the grease, then clean the stain with a mild soap such as Marseille soap. So whether it’s a butter stain or worse a vegetable oil stain, start by testing this trick to clean the tablecloth.

Stained … itsy bitsy spider by carly simonWebMay 6, 2024 · Mix 1/4 cup of baking soda with 1/4 cup of water, adding more baking soda or water until the mixture forms a paste. Rub the baking soda paste onto the stain with an unused toothbrush. Allow it to sit for a few hours or overnight. Then, rinse and repeat as needed.
